I think a lot of people are misinterpreting the theme. I don't think it just applies to letting go of the fear of death, but to move on in general. Emily kept this grudge for so long and vowed to find her "true love", but in doing this she realized she would be not only killing Victor, but shattering Victoria's happiness to maintain her own. It proved to be a truly clever song, not only having jazzy skeletons, but giving a moral theme and telling a story simultaneously, with the pieces coming together only at the end.
